Technical field
The present invention relates to high quality printing system, is a kind of holographic shading radium-shine wrappage press quality amount detection systems and detection method specifically.
Background technology
In high-grade packages printing; color effect is dazzled for outstanding packaging is apparent; usual printing adopts radium-shine printable fabric; and be the antifalsification improving packaging further on this basis; asynchronous Antiforge that plate aligned transfer, that have Brand characteristic at random on radium-shine printable fabric, to improve the protection of enterprise's legitimate interests.But along with the apparent effect of material is complicated, the technology carried also needs to improve, and at present for radium-shine class material, due to the impact by its surperficial laser effect, image acquisition cannot obtain the more stable data that maybe can represent whole structure, cause quality testing in this respect to never have the comparatively effective detection means of one and technology, the printable fabric as band poster edge causes great difficulty to quality testing especially.
Printing operation due to radium-shine shading is not in the end carry out, prior art cannot be carried out the printed matter printing quality with the not radium-shine shading in fixed position in printing semi-manufacture process, end product quality final is at present due to the impact of the not radium-shine shading of fixed position, automatically cannot be completed by equipment, the final quality inspection of a large amount of high quality printing product only has and completes by sampling range estimation, if carry out shielding to radium-shine shading will destroy sample pattern in the quality testing of image contrast method, because not fixing of position appears in radium-shine shading, also the inconsistent spot in sample pattern cannot be got rid of by software.

Printing operation due to radium-shine shading is not in the end carry out, prior art cannot be completed by equipment automatically to the printed matter printing quality with the not radium-shine shading in fixed position, the final quality inspection of a large amount of high quality printing product only has and completes by sampling range estimation, if carry out shielding to radium-shine shading will destroy sample pattern in the quality testing of image contrast method, because not fixing of position appears in radium-shine shading, the inconsistent spot in sample pattern also cannot be got rid of by software.This programme make use of the difference of radium-shine shading to the diffusing characteristic diffuser of the orientation consistency of light reflection and non-radium-shine shading, by CCD scanning head and LED light source with test product aligned in position after asymmetric arrangement, and Automatic-searching avoids laser reflection point optimum position, can realize effectively getting rid of the radium-shine shading interference of not fixed position after simply transforming former pick-up unit, the process of simulation eye recognition, and detection effect efficient stable.
The present invention program requires low to LED light source, do not limit diffuse reflection light source, on the contrary, because radium-shine shading is to the reflection of orientation consistency direct light, make CCD scanning head after avoiding laser reflection light, remainder, to the diffusion of light, can reduce the pattern effect of printed matter well after process after filtering, and therefore this programme have employed the light source that direct light and diffused light combine.
Therefore, after the present invention has carried out the improvement of low cost on former printed matter detection scheme basis, solve well for the test problems with the not printed matter printing quality of the radium-shine shading in fixed position.

Embodiment
Below in conjunction with drawings and Examples, the present invention is further described: as Fig. 1, shown in 2, described holographic shading radium-shine wrappage press quality amount detection systems, for detecting the apparent mass of the not radium-shine shading printed matter of fixed position, LED light source 3 and CCD scanning head 2 is had in the arranged outside of a transhipment roller 4 of support holographic laser shading printed sheet, described CCD scanning head 2 is arranged on to be kept away on laser light driving mechanism 1, described LED light source 3 and the asymmetric both sides being arranged at check point 17 normal of CCD scanning head 2, this is kept away laser light driving mechanism 1 and at least can to move through check point 17 and with the rectilinear in planes of transhipment roller 4 axes normal and around central shaft autorotation, enable CCD scanning head collect the clear pattern of printing by the reflected light of LED light source for adjusting CCD scanning head 2 and avoid the reflected light of radium-shine shading.Detect and undertaken by the transhipment roller of support printed matter, sweep in conjunction with CCD line, effectively can prevent the reflection graphic patterns problem on deformation because printed matter surface out-of-flatness brings.For for the reflection avoided with the not radium-shine shading in fixed position, the adjustment that CCD scanning head only needs translation and rotates two degree of freedom can be carried out.As prioritization scheme, described LED light source 3 is arranged on one independently on multidimensional driving mechanism 18, what described CCD scanning head 2 was installed keep away laser light driving mechanism 1 can carry out position and the angular adjustment of 6 degree of freedom, for the pre-adjustment to light source irradiation position and image information collecting position.
In the printing surface side of the tested printed sheet 5 in described transhipment roller 4 front, position transducer 15 is housed, range sensor 14 is equipped with in the rotating shaft of described transhipment roller 4, for accurately obtaining the position of sample pattern; As a kind of embodiment, described range sensor 14 is mounted in the scrambler of transhipment roller 4 rotating shaft, and described position transducer 15 is the photoelectric sensors identifying printed sheet photoelectric mark.Pattern to be detected can be located in conjunction with the positioning mark on printed matter by position transducer 15 and range sensor 14 exactly, determines the sample range of CCD scanning.
Described detection system is provided with controller 12, the drive motor 16 driving printed sheet to transmit controls rotating speed by described controller, for controlling drive motor 16 when carrying out pick-up pattern to CCD scanning head 2 and avoiding the adjustment of radium-shine shading reflected light lower than rated speed half-speed operation, behind the optimum position obtaining CCD scanning head 2 and/or angle, controlling drive motor 16 run well.
The information output of described CCD scanning head 2 is connected respectively to the input end of comparison amplifier 9 with master sample information 7 after low-pass filter 8, and the output terminal of comparison amplifier 9 connects alarm 10.
Described controller 12 is connected with storer 11, for storing the scanning information of described CCD scanning head 2 and the image information after low-pass filter 8 processes.Described detection system is provided with display 13, for showing the pattern after the process of master sample pattern, sampled scan pattern and low-pass filter 8.
Based on the holographic shading radium-shine wrappage press quality quantity measuring method of above-mentioned holographic shading radium-shine wrappage press quality amount detection systems, when carrying out the printing of each batch, complete the quality testing of printing printed sheet with the not radium-shine shading in fixed position according to following step:
The first step, to transhipment roller 4 pattern direction to be measured light LED light source 3, to transmit tested printed matter lower than the low speed of normal speed half;
The position of second step, adjustment CCD scanning head 2 and LED light source 3 and angle, until the pattern that CCD scanning head 2 gathers conforms to position with the size of standard model pattern; Determined the initial sum end time of a width pick-up pattern by the feedback signal of position transducer 15 and range sensor 14, gather test product pattern.
3rd step, driving keep away laser light driving mechanism 1, make CCD scanning head 2 through check point 17 and with the plane of transhipment roller 4 axes normal in do translation and to move and around the autorotation of central shaft, in contrast pick-up pattern, the effect of laser reflection light, gets CCD scanning head 2 position corresponding to the minimum pattern of laser reflection influence of light and angle;
4th step, startup rated speed transmit tested printed sheet;
5th step, to gathered pattern-information filtering process, compared by the pattern after filtering process with master sample information, gained deviation is greater than threshold value and then starts alert program, otherwise continues to detect next printed sheet.Send display to show in master sample pattern and the pattern after gathering filtering process, be convenient to hand inspection.Pattern after pattern after storage of collected and filtering process, puts on record as inspection.Preserve the deviate of the pattern-information after also statistical filtering process and master sample information, recommend rational deviation judgment threshold according to statistic algorithm.
From above-mentioned detection scheme, the present invention is in adjustment LED light source and CCD scanning head position, and after can accurately determining the sampling of pattern, also to carry out the adjustment of the reflected light avoiding laser light, to realize the present invention is directed to the object with the not printed matter print quality inspection of the radium-shine shading in fixed position.
